Latest Patents

Hikaru Sugimoto holds a patent for a method for manufacturing microstructures that include cured products of photosensitive resin compositions. This method involves several steps, including forming at least two layers of photosensitive resin compositions, each containing a photopolymerization initiator. The process includes patterning exposure and collectively developing the exposed layers to obtain a microstructure. Notably, 90% by mass or more of the photopolymerization initiators in at least one of the adjacent layers is a nonionic photopolymerization initiator.
